Do I Have to go to Court if I File for Bankruptcy?

Debtors must attend a meeting of creditors, also known as a section 341 hearing. They testify under oath that the details provided in their bankruptcy file are correct, usually near the courthouse and presided over by the bankruptcy trustee. If I’m Married, Does my Spouse have to File for Bankruptcy as Well?

Can you File for Bankruptcy Individually? Yes, you can file for bankruptcy individually and leave your spouse out of the process. However, your spouse will still be affected by the bankruptcy as they then become responsible for all joint debts.
